11 former Rutgers players in the NFL Playoffs
By Matt Sugam
When the NFL playoffs kickoff this weekend, 11 former Rutgers players will be on playoff rosters. Six of those players’ teams will be playing this weekend.
Courtesy of Rutgers athletics, here’s the complete list of the former Rutgers players in the playoffs, and those playing this weekend.
